Oklahoma HB3376 repeals tax credits for certain automobile manufacturing activity.

Oklahoma HB3376 repeals 68 O.S. 2021, Section 2357.404, which provides tax credits for certain automobile manufacturing activity. The bill removes these tax credits, affecting companies involved in automobile manufacturing within the state. The repeal takes effect on November 1, 2026.
